Part of dealing with or beating any fear or phobia is repeat desensitizing of the situation. I just happened upon this in-flight screensaver mid-year. It's great since I'm next to my computer most each working day, and when it's idle, my computer is 35,000 feet in the air and I'm looking out the window just as I would if I were flying. For me, it's a great tool for the mind of a fearful flyer. So when the day comes for real flight, the anxiety level is lower and my mind is well prepared for successful adventure. Software Info: Holding Pattern turns your idle computer screen into an airplane window, complete with a moving aerial view. It generates a random flight every time your computer plays it. Sometimes you will encounter rare views that have a low probability. You might also catch Holding Pattern's own flight-safety diagrams. Be patient and let the screensaver play for a while, and you'll see this flight does have a destination. (My NOTE: no it doesn't...you just keep flying, but that's OK.)
Download.com Review: If you enjoy gazing out of an airplane window at the landscape below, the Holding Pattern Screensaver gives you this sensation time and time again. This screensaver brings to your desktop an ample stream of cinematic images photographed through an airplane window. We liked the fact that Holding Pattern contains a variety of images, from picturesque snow-covered mountains to more average fare such as a resting baby. This program's only downside is that it takes up a little too much of your system resources for a screensaver. Nevertheless, we still think Holding Pattern is a beautifully designed, fun app to have on your PC.
